How to check it instead. No public register exists. Ask for a certificate of insurance naming you and the address, issued by the broker rather than forwarded by the contractor, and ring the broker on the number printed on it.

This work usually needs a municipal permit. Confirm in writing who pulls it. A contractor who offers to skip it is offering you a disclosure problem at resale and a declined claim if something goes wrong.
